S B Moraes is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Radiation. According to data from OpenAlex, S B Moraes has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 702 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Nuclear and High Energy Physics, 7 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 5 papers in Radiation. Recurrent topics in S B Moraes’s work include Nuclear physics research studies (9 papers), Atomic and Molecular Physics (7 papers) and Nuclear Physics and Applications (4 papers). S B Moraes is often cited by papers focused on Nuclear physics research studies (9 papers), Atomic and Molecular Physics (7 papers) and Nuclear Physics and Applications (4 papers). S B Moraes coll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, Chile and Australia. S B Moraes's co-authors include P. R. S. Gomes, R. M. Anjos, J. Lubián, N. Carlin, M. Dasgupta, A. C. Berriman, D. J. Hinde, C. R. Morton, R. D. Butt and J.O. Newton and has published in prestigious journals such as The European Physical Journal A, Journal of Physics G Nuclear and Particle Physics and Brazilian Journal of Physics.
